Jiang Mohan is a student who stayed at home until moldy due to the epidemic. He looked forward to the stars and the moon and finally looked forward to the end of the epidemic. He made an appointment with his best friend to go to school together, but he did not expect that he died unexpectedly on the way to the appointment and came to the world of cultivation that can only be found in novels. You see, other people's identities in time travel are either awesome demon bosses or monks with a strong sense of justice, but he, hey, actually dressed as a little beggar. It doesn't matter, isn't he just a little beggar? Who is he? He is a person from the 22nd century. It won't be a matter of minutes if he wants to counterattack. Through his unremitting efforts, he successfully became a disciple of the talented monk Jiang Yan. He thought that a beautiful and happy life was about to come, but he didn't expect that his master turned out to be the male protagonist in the book. So wouldn't he become the apprentice who died young next to the male protagonist? This plot is wrong. What about the promised counterattack and becoming the final boss?
